Job Overview & Essential Functions

Murphy-Hoffman Company, LLC is North America's largest Kenworth truck dealership group and leasing group. As MHC continues to grow, we have an opening for a Used Truck Sales Manager. The role of the Used Truck Sales Manager plans and directs the used truck marketing activities of the branch or branches assigned. Plans, organizes, directs, and controls the efforts of used truck sales and maintenance personnel in the accomplishment of company objective.
  • Directs and coordinates all activities of the Used Truck Department at branch or branches assigned in accomplishing objectives and defined sales goals.
  • Develops a sales and marketing program to achieve specific sales and net profit target based on current market conditions.
  • Evaluates Used Truck Department performance against established targets and standards and takes appropriate action as necessary. Appraises performance of used truck sales personnel against established standards and targets.
  • Controls used truck inventory turns and gross profit, through analyzation of market potential for used trucks both retail and wholesale; appraises used trucks for resale as to reconditioning requirements for retail or wholesale.
  • Develops and trains Used Truck Department sales personnel to ensure objectives are met; assists in selling efforts where necessary.
  • Establishes and maintains satisfactory relations with outside wholesalers, dealers, and auction companies.
  • Maintains understanding and acceptance within all other departments throughout the branch or branches.

About Us

MHC is an expansion of the original company, Ozark Kenworth, Inc. Ozark Kenworth started in Springfield, Missouri, in January 1975. Opening for business without a Parts or Service department and only three employees in a temporary facility. From there, the company grew and expanded. MHC is now a multi-state network of full-service diesel truck dealerships, leasing and rental operations, transport refrigeration locations, and a finance company which offers a complete array of finance and insurance services.
